A prefix to a coordinate name is enclosed in parentheses. The presence/absence of a “J” indicates that the epoch of the coordinates is J2000/B1950.
Year of initial X-ray outburst/total number of X-ray outbursts.
Period and f(M) corrections by AM Levine and D Lin, private communication.
Colon denotes uncertain value or range.
Additional outbursts in optical archives: A 0620 (1917) and V404 Cyg (1938, 1956).
Casares et al. 2004; possible alias period of 61.5 hr.
Orosz et al. 2004.
Estimated by Kong et al. 2002.
Hynes et al. 2003.
Period confirmed by A.M. Levine and D. Lin, private communication.
“Q” denotes quasi-persistent intervals (e.g., decades), rather than typical outburst.Source: Remillard & McClintock 2006 ┃ X-Ray Properties… ⚬𓂃
